哈希表 单词在任意一本书中出现的频率表
来源:互联网 发布:如何关掉mysql服务 编辑:程序博客网 时间:2024/05/20 15:40
package com.NodePair;
import java.util.HashMap;
public class Frequency {
HashMap<String,Integer> setupDictionary(String[] book)
{
HashMap<String,Integer> table=new HashMap<String,Integer>();
for(String s:book)
{
s=s.toLowerCase();
if(!table.containsKey(s))
{
table.put(s,0);
}
table.put(s, table.get(s)+1);
}
return table;
}
int getFrequency(HashMap<String,Integer> table,String word)
{
if(table==null||word==null)
return -1;
word=word.toLowerCase();
if(table.containsKey(word))
{
return table.get(word);
}
return 0;
}
}
import java.util.HashMap;
public class Frequency {
HashMap<String,Integer> setupDictionary(String[] book)
{
HashMap<String,Integer> table=new HashMap<String,Integer>();
for(String s:book)
{
s=s.toLowerCase();
if(!table.containsKey(s))
{
table.put(s,0);
}
table.put(s, table.get(s)+1);
}
return table;
}
int getFrequency(HashMap<String,Integer> table,String word)
{
if(table==null||word==null)
return -1;
word=word.toLowerCase();
if(table.containsKey(word))
{
return table.get(word);
}
return 0;
}
}
0 0
- 哈希表 单词在任意一本书中出现的频率表
- 程序员面试金典——解题总结: 9.17中等难题 17.9设计一个方法,找出任意指定单词在一本书中的出现频率
- 请编写一个程序,一本书中需要打印哪些单词出现频率在前20
- 统计一TXT文档中单词出现频率,输出频率最高的10个单词
- Hadoop Demo(一)【统计文件中单词出现的频率】
- 从书中查找某个单词出现的频率
- 统计文件中单词出现的频率
- 计算单词出现的频率
- 统计一篇文章中单词出现的频率
- 查找文本中n个出现频率最高的单词
- STL统计英文中单词出现频率的问题
- 统计文本中各单词出现的频率(JavaWeb)
- 统计文章中出现的单词频率java小程序
- 分析一个英文txt文本中单词出现的频率
- 查找文本中n个出现频率最高的单词
- python实现统计文本中单词出现的频率
- 用hash表统计文本文件中每个单词出现的频率
- 统计文件中各单词出现的频率(Hash表实现)
- JavaScript代码收集
- DB2的备份(backup)和恢复(RESTORE)数据库方法
- Devexpress ASP.NET中ASPxTreeList节点的拖动
- PHP使用Smarty模板目录结构配置
- xml 解析 python
- 哈希表 单词在任意一本书中出现的频率表
- Fragments APIs
- C语言文件操作函数大全
- android分辨率
- 15个编程好习惯
- 浅谈UML中的聚合与组合
- svn重设日志内容 及 如何修改SVN已提交项目的message log
- 通俗的去理解 wait()和notify()
- 关于background【有更新已解决】